#c5904f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c5904f is composed of 77.3% red, 56.5%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.9% magenta, 59.9%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 33.1 degrees, a saturation of 50.4% and a lightness of 54.1%. #c5904f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9e with #8b2100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#c5904f color description : Moderate orange.

#c5904f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c5904f has RGB values of R:197, G:144,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.6,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12947535.

Shades and Tints of #c5904f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#faf6f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c5904f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8b85 is the less saturated color, while #fb9519 is the most saturated one.
